On Saturday, the Sandhills/Thedford Knights came up short against the Wauneta-Palisade Broncos and fell 2-0. The Knights have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Sandhills/Thedford may have fallen short, but they were sure consistent: they scored 16 points in every single set they played. The match finished with set scores of 25-16, 25-16.
Sandhills/Thedford's defeat dropped their record down to 6-6. As for Wauneta-Palisade, they are on a roll lately: they've won three of their last four contests, which provided a nice bump to their 10-6 record this season.
Sandhills/Thedford did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next matchup, a 2-1 loss against Ravenna on the 28th. Wauneta-Palisade has also already played their next game, a 2-1 defeat against Bertrand on the 28th.
